About Butchersfield

Butchersfield is a mountain summit in the Stockport to Stafford and Derby region in the county of Warrington, England. Butchersfield is 44 metres high with a prominence of 34 metres. Butchersfield Summit Stats

Height in Metres: 44 metres

Height in Feet: 144 feet

Range: Stockport to Stafford and Derby

Prominence: 34 metres

Parent Summit: Shining Tor

Grid Reference: SJ677889

Col Height: 10

Col Grid Reference: SJ678887
